Understanding Video-on-Demand: A Beginner's Guide

Video-on-Demand (VOD) represents a revolution in how we consume entertainment. Essentially , it permits viewers to get movies, shows and other videos whenever they desire . Unlike regular television, which depends on fixed broadcast slots , VOD gives you full control over your viewing experience . Here's a brief explanation at what you need to realize:

  • Subscription-Based VOD: Platforms like copyright, Disney+ offer a wide array of shows for a recurring charge .
  • Transactional VOD (TVOD): You rent for individual movie or show – like buying a DVD.
  • Ad-Supported VOD (AVOD): These services offer free streaming in exchange for watching advertisements.

VOD has completely reshaped the industry of entertainment, offering amazing convenience for viewers everywhere .

Video Clip Streaming: Improving for Handheld Devices

To deliver a pleasant audience more info journey on handheld devices, video clip delivery requires precise tuning. This includes implementing adaptive bitrate transmission, which dynamically adjusts the video resolution based on the viewer's connection. Furthermore, compressing video with efficient compression algorithms such as HEVC and employing low-latency buffering methods are vital for preventing buffering and ensuring a smooth viewing session.
